It's not my own plugin (this plugin was made by a certain Spacedude), I only took it from the amxmod-site, compiled it with the amx mod x compiler and tested it on our server. It works fine.

Just take the amx-file and put it into the plugins-directory, add a line for the plugin to the plugins.ini and it works. Then put a soundfiles.txt - file into the moddirectory (for example cstrike, dod and so on) and write the customsoundfiles into it, that players shall load on connect.


Example:

You installed Counter-Strike, you have to put the soundfiles.txt there:
c:\Programs\hlds\cstrike

Then you put your customsound into the soundfolder. If you are using sounds with a common name, that can be found only at your server, it might be a good idea to create a custom directory.

Example:

You want the sounds yeah.wav and yippiiee.wav to be loaded:
You put them into a directory named myserverstuff

There pathes are now:
c:\Programs\hlds\cstrike\sound\myserverstuff\ yeah.wav
c:\Programs\hlds\cstrike\sound\myserverstuff\ yippiiee.wav


Into the soundfile.txt you only write:
myserverstuff\yeah.wav
myserverstuff\yippiiee.wav



Ready!
Now connect to your server and the soundfiles should load (only if you dont already have them).
